Mac Culpepper
Operations Manager
Born and raised in Maryland, I grew up as a passionate Washington, D.C. sports fan and played just about every sport I could, including football, soccer, lacrosse, basketball, and, of course, flag football. I attended Our Lady of Good Counsel High School before earning my degree in Sports Management and Business from Xavier University, where I managed the university's rugby team.
I joined Flag Star as a referee in the fall of 2022 and quickly discovered a passion for the organization's mission and community. Today, I oversee league operations/logistics and develop systems and processes that help create a more efficient organization while delivering an exceptional experience for our athletes, families, coaches, and staff.
Outside of work, you'll usually find me watching sports or spending time with friends.
